Web66-150 g. Length. 255-266 mm. The eastern chipmunk ( Tamias striatus ) is a chipmunk species found in eastern North America. It is the only living member of the chipmunk subgenus Tamias, sometimes recognized as a different genus. The name "chipmunk" comes from the Ojibwe word ᐊᒋᑕᒨ ajidamoo (or possibly ajidamoonh, the same word in …
WebTownsend's chipmunks live in Pacific Northwest of North America, from British Columbia through western Washington and Oregon. They inhabit dense forests and brush thickets. They can also be found in more open areas with logs, shrubs, evergreen herbs, trees, and a variety of fungi and lichens.
